Imperative of German verb flüchten
The conjugation of flüchten (flee, escape) in the imperative is: flüchte (du), flüchten wir, flüchtet (ihr), flüchten Sie. The imperative is formed with the stem of present tense flücht. The endings -e, -en, -et, -en are appended to the stem. The ending of the 2nd Person Singular is extended by an e, as the stem ends in t. The personal pronoun is usually omitted in the 2nd person singular.The formation of the forms corresponds to the grammatical rules for the conjugation of the verbs in imperative. Comments ☆
